To those of you who are making or have produced rum...
I was wondering if you are pre-treating to remove ash, or fermenting and distilling as is. If you are pre-treating, what are you using?

We have been making rum for about 5 years now... and have never treated our molasses... thats not to say if we could afford a centrifugal filter that we wouldnt try to clean it up... the less undissolved solids in it, the more efficient the fermentation and consequently the distillation would be

We settle solids out by mixing the molasses with hot water and letting it settle for a few days in a conical mash tank.
